1. Sherry has installed two DNS servers to resolve hostnames on her company's intranet. Now she wants to install a third DNS server to resolve hostnames on the Internet root name servers. What is the best way for Sherry to configure this DNS server?
a. by including the InterNIC IP address in the HOSTS file on the DNS server
b. by setting the default gateway of the DNS server to the IP address of the InterNIC
c. by using the boot file on the DNS server
d. by using the cache.dns file on the DNS server
Answer: d
2. Carol has added a second router on a subnet to provide for redundancy. One of the routers fails. Users of Windows NT Workstation computers on the subnet complain that they can no longer communicate with the Windows NT Server computers on remote subnets. Carol checks the second router and finds that it is still functioning. What step must Carol take to prevent this problem from recurring the next time a router fails?
a. assign each workstation a second default gateway address
b. assign each workstation a second IP address
c. install DHCP Relay Agents on each router; reserve each router's IP address on WINS
d. set up a WINS proxy on each subnet
Answer: a
3. You are brought in as a consultant to set up TCP/IP on a network of Microsoft Windows-based computers. The network is comprised of five subnets, each with its own domain controller. Every host must be able to browse every other computer and perform peer-to-peer connections. The network must also register and resolve computer names automatically through a central database. What is the best choice to install on the network?
a. DHCP servers
b. DNS servers
c. HOSTS files
d. WINS servers
e. the SNMP service on all domain controllers
Answer: d

6. Suppose the following situation exists Amanda's company is headquartered in Miami with a second office in Chicago. Both offices use TCP/IP as the networking protocol. The Miami office has ten Windows NT Server computers and 1,000 Windows NT Workstation computer clients. The Chicago office has two Windows NT Server computers and 225 Windows NT Workstation computer clients. The WINS server in Miami is called MIA; the WINS server in Chicago is called CHI. Amanda wants to set up WINS database replication between the two WINS servers.
Required result:
She must replicate the Miami WINS server database to the Chicago WINS server.
Optional desired results:
1) She wants to replicate the Chicago WINS server data to the Miami WINS server.
2) She wants to be sure that the Miami WINS database is replicated to Chicago at least once a day.
Proposed solution:
Configure Miami to push its WINS database update information to Chicago once every 1000 updates. Configure Chicago to pull Miami's WINS database update information once every 24 hours.
Which results does the proposed solution produce?
a. The proposed solution produces the required result and both of the optional desired results.
b. The proposed solution produces the required result and one of the optional desired results.
c. The proposed solution produces the required result and none of the optional desired results.
d. The proposed solution does not produce the required result.
Answer: b
7. A coworker on a Windows NT Workstation computer named NTWA10 on SubnetA cannot connect to a Windows NT Server computer on SubnetB with the command NET USE F: \\bserv.corp.com\data. Using another Windows computer on SubnetA, you succeed in making the same connection with the command NET USE F:\\bserv.corp.com\data. What is the most likely cause of the problem?
a. NTWA10 is not set up with the IP address of the DNS server.
b. NTWA10 is not set up with the IP address of the WINS server.
c. The DNS server has no entry for bserv.corp.com.
d. The DNS server is not set up for NetBIOS name resolution.
Answer: a

12. Cindy has just installed the DNS service on a Windows NT Server computer. She needs to add a resource record for her domain's mail server. Which resource record must she add?
a. CNAME
b. MX
c. PTR
d. WKS
Answer: b

14. 45. From her Windows NT Workstation computer, Samantha tries to connect to a Windows NT Server computer located on a remote subnet. Samantha's workstation is configured to use WINS, a HOSTS file, and an LMHOSTS file.
Using Windows NT Explorer, Samantha wants to map a drive to a Universal Naming Convention (UNC) name on the remote server SSPMARKET. The SSPMARKET server is not WINS-enabled. When she enters the network path to the \records folder on SSPMARKET called \\sspmarket\records, she receives the error message: "The computer or share name could not be found." However, when Samantha pings the host address sspmarket.com, the SSPMARKET server responds. What is the most likely cause of the problem?
a. The workstation is not using m-node broadcasts for UNC name resolution.
b. The address of the WINS server is incorrectly entered on Samantha's workstation.
c. The IP address of the remote server SSPMARKET.COM is not correctly entered in the workstation's HOSTS file.
d. The IP address of the remote server SSPMARKET is not correctly entered in the workstation's LMHOSTS file.
Answer: d
